- Title
Risk-based environmental control and process monitoring in aseptic processing.
- Authors
Drinkwater, James L.; Van Laere, Marc
- Abstract
Risk-based environmental control, delivered by technical and organisational good manufacturing practice (GMP) control measures, are inherently linked to risk-based environmental monitoring (EM) and trend data analysis. Process monitoring is reported as a developing requirement in the revision of the EU Guidelines to Good Manufacturing Practice Annex 1 which combines all EM programs through classification/characterisation, media fills/process simulations, routine EM and batch/shift end surface sampling as one plan. This article considers the control measures for environmental control in different aseptically processed product types together with requirements in risk-based EM.
